Christian Hesse pushed to branch main at Arch Linux / Packaging / Packages / 
syslinux


Commits:
661320c3 by Christian Hesse at 2024-09-30T22:36:06+02:00
upgpkg: 6.04.pre3.r3.g05ac953c-2: pull in latest upstream commits

- - - - -


3 changed files:

- .SRCINFO
- 0005-Workaround-multiple-definition-of-symbol-errors.patch
- PKGBUILD


Changes:

=====================================
.SRCINFO
=====================================
@@ -1,7 +1,7 @@
 pkgbase = syslinux
        pkgdesc = Collection of boot loaders that boot from FAT, ext2/3/4 and 
btrfs filesystems, from CDs and via PXE
-       pkgver = 6.04.pre2.r11.gbf6db5b4
-       pkgrel = 7
+       pkgver = 6.04.pre3.r3.g05ac953c
+       pkgrel = 2
        url = https://www.syslinux.org/
        install = syslinux.install
        arch = x86_64
@@ -20,7 +20,7 @@ pkgbase = syslinux
        optdepends = dosfstools: For EFI support
        options = !makeflags
        options = !buildflags
-       source = 
git+https://repo.or.cz/syslinux.git#commit=bf6db5b48ec25f83939f1fdebb59028bc3c40b00
+       source = 
git+https://repo.or.cz/syslinux.git#commit=05ac953c23f90b2328d393f7eecde96e41aed067
        source = syslinux.cfg
        source = syslinux-install_update
        source = 0002-gfxboot-menu-label.patch
@@ -34,7 +34,7 @@ pkgbase = syslinux
        source = 0006-Replace-builtin-strlen-that-appears-to-get-optimized.patch
        source = 0026-add-missing-include.patch
        source = 0027-use-correct-type-for-size.patch
-       sha256sums = 
68114f20d8cd35803053d8633d2ada641b264978d6fcf46ee132ad9447a727bd
+       sha256sums = 
deec61086a2cb73163d50e150d1ef32bd56c8a3faa1fc4322d11080ba0cbe63a
        sha256sums = 
b9692be0cce43811c1b04053072ac50dd7b39bbc2ba7bcbe0e4387668af8df08
        sha256sums = 
6b7a1dae92052226d4958f28f8302b8bf7725ce75895986105d4799234efcbbe
        sha256sums = 
d1fe9084ce2526619f94b8a07b89fb0194e874beef9f202f8b974879d77f2e1a
@@ -44,7 +44,7 @@ pkgbase = syslinux
        sha256sums = 
7facb5c2abc71c9bfe01bf4db388306ed7b7abf6654009af336262839527f962
        sha256sums = 
755cd7062fe8495f6f62053ce664451c12ae65dba9fb5c75062a495fbe040fb1
        sha256sums = 
9a76f6f75a42485bc337163ba38068b09f7889bdc1a4e191408898f10de36662
-       sha256sums = 
7e41e17e8cbc7287d6c3c9eb0a7b682cd8d3252030856b338050c21dff9bf05a
+       sha256sums = 
a3b5ee376f9ab56313932ce7fb363cd702fe503276ab84702ae0bb7eef10eb91
        sha256sums = 
d7410d0ff89a15e2a100faf1546d730e043dde15c295974564144e00a93f03a3
        sha256sums = 
e16e051d17ead7e6457a479a1e2226160ca9aae3d607c0c25fa3677522aa9280
        sha256sums = 
7f2ce9e16ddcca1a55b32bddfd39c7f190eed9d8df4319bbd6b07e0a2607e662


=====================================
0005-Workaround-multiple-definition-of-symbol-errors.patch
=====================================
@@ -72,7 +72,7 @@ index 46cb037c..f0cfcbe9 100644
 @@ -156,7 +156,7 @@ LDSCRIPT = $(SRC)/$(ARCH)/syslinux.ld
  NASM_ELF = elf
  
- %.elf: %.o $(LIBDEP) $(LDSCRIPT) $(AUXLIBS)
+ %.elf: %.o %-c.o lib%.a $(LIBDEP) $(LDSCRIPT)
 -      $(LD) $(LDFLAGS) -pie -Bsymbolic \
 +      $(LD) $(LDFLAGS) -z muldefs -pie -Bsymbolic \
                -T $(LDSCRIPT) \


=====================================
PKGBUILD
=====================================
@@ -4,10 +4,10 @@
 # Contributor: Keshav Amburay <(the ddoott ridikulus ddoott rat) (aatt) 
(gemmaeiil) (ddoott) (ccoomm)>
 
 pkgname=syslinux
-pkgver=6.04.pre2.r11.gbf6db5b4
+pkgver=6.04.pre3.r3.g05ac953c
 #_tag=syslinux-$pkgver
-_commit=bf6db5b48ec25f83939f1fdebb59028bc3c40b00
-pkgrel=7
+_commit='05ac953c23f90b2328d393f7eecde96e41aed067'
+pkgrel=2
 pkgdesc='Collection of boot loaders that boot from FAT, ext2/3/4 and btrfs 
filesystems, from CDs and via PXE'
 url='https://www.syslinux.org/'
 arch=(x86_64)
@@ -43,7 +43,7 @@ source=(git+https://repo.or.cz/syslinux.git#commit=$_commit
         0026-add-missing-include.patch
         0027-use-correct-type-for-size.patch
 )
-sha256sums=('68114f20d8cd35803053d8633d2ada641b264978d6fcf46ee132ad9447a727bd'
+sha256sums=('deec61086a2cb73163d50e150d1ef32bd56c8a3faa1fc4322d11080ba0cbe63a'
             'b9692be0cce43811c1b04053072ac50dd7b39bbc2ba7bcbe0e4387668af8df08'
             '6b7a1dae92052226d4958f28f8302b8bf7725ce75895986105d4799234efcbbe'
             'd1fe9084ce2526619f94b8a07b89fb0194e874beef9f202f8b974879d77f2e1a'
@@ -53,7 +53,7 @@ 
sha256sums=('68114f20d8cd35803053d8633d2ada641b264978d6fcf46ee132ad9447a727bd'
             '7facb5c2abc71c9bfe01bf4db388306ed7b7abf6654009af336262839527f962'
             '755cd7062fe8495f6f62053ce664451c12ae65dba9fb5c75062a495fbe040fb1'
             '9a76f6f75a42485bc337163ba38068b09f7889bdc1a4e191408898f10de36662'
-            '7e41e17e8cbc7287d6c3c9eb0a7b682cd8d3252030856b338050c21dff9bf05a'
+            'a3b5ee376f9ab56313932ce7fb363cd702fe503276ab84702ae0bb7eef10eb91'
             'd7410d0ff89a15e2a100faf1546d730e043dde15c295974564144e00a93f03a3'
             'e16e051d17ead7e6457a479a1e2226160ca9aae3d607c0c25fa3677522aa9280'
             '7f2ce9e16ddcca1a55b32bddfd39c7f190eed9d8df4319bbd6b07e0a2607e662')



View it on GitLab: 
https://gitlab.archlinux.org/archlinux/packaging/packages/syslinux/-/commit/661320c3c21e17538fc5b23892ed1e853e61ca0c

-- 
View it on GitLab: 
https://gitlab.archlinux.org/archlinux/packaging/packages/syslinux/-/commit/661320c3c21e17538fc5b23892ed1e853e61ca0c
You're receiving this email because of your account on gitlab.archlinux.org.


Reply via email to